Huawei P40 series official launch on 26th March

The launch event of Huawei P40 series will not take place in Paris, France, it will be delivered entirely online. The event is said to be entirely online due to the fear of Coronavirus. The P40 series is the next flagship from the company which features a big camera bump in the image.

The Huawei P40 lineup will contain three smartphones as the CEO declares. The lineup will consist of Huawei P40, P40 Pro and even the P40 Premium Edition. The teaser also gives us a sneak peek of the camera setup, which will sit on an impressively big bump that was rumored to hold at least five shooters.

All the Huawei P40 phones are coming e with Kirin 990 chipset, although some of them might have the 5G variant of the SoC, depending on the market. According to earlier rumors, the P40 will be the most affordable of three, the P40 Pro comes with a 52MP main camera + 40MP cine shooter + 8MP telephoto module with a 125mm lens.

The P40 Premium Edition’s five cameras will include everything you ever wanted from a smartphone camera setup – an ultrawide angle shooter, a periscope telephoto lens, a massive sensor for the main cam, ToF sensor and even a macro cam for all those close-up shots.
